UltraLite C/C++ common API reference

This section lists functions and macros that you can use with either the embedded SQL or C++ interface. Most of the functions in this section require a SQL Communications Area.

 Header file

Macros and compiler directives for UltraLite C/C++ applications
UL_RS_STATE enumeration
ul_column_sql_type enumeration
ul_column_storage_type enumeration
ul_error_action enumeration
ul_sync_state enumeration
ul_validate_status_id enumeration
ul_binary structure
ul_error_info structure
ul_stream_error structure
ul_sync_info structure
ul_sync_result structure
ul_sync_stats structure
ul_sync_status structure
ul_validate_data structure
ULVF_DATABASE variable
ULVF_EXPRESS variable
ULVF_FULL_VALIDATE variable
ULVF_IDX_HASH variable
ULVF_IDX_REDUNDANT variable
ULVF_INDEX variable
ULVF_TABLE variable
UL_AS_SYNCHRONIZE variable
UL_SYNC_ALL variable
UL_SYNC_ALL_PUBS variable
UL_SYNC_STATUS_FLAG_IS_BLOCKING variable
UL_TEXT variable
UL_VALID_IS_ERROR variable
UL_VALID_IS_INFO variable